Ro system installation services involve setting up a point-of-use or whole-house water filtration system designed to improve the quality of tap water. These services typically include assessing the property’s water supply, selecting the appropriate filtration unit, and professionally installing the equipment to ensure it functions correctly. Proper installation helps ensure that the system operates efficiently, providing clean, safe drinking water directly from the tap. Homeowners seeking a reliable solution for better-tasting water or to reduce contaminants often turn to local contractors specializing in Ro system setups.

Many common water issues can be addressed with a properly installed reverse osmosis (Ro) system. These problems include the presence of dissolved solids, chlorine, heavy metals, or other impurities that may affect the taste, odor, or safety of drinking water. An Ro system can also help reduce mineral buildup and improve the overall quality of water used for cooking and drinking. Property owners who notice a decline in water quality, experience unusual tastes or odors, or have concerns about contaminants are often advised to consider professional installation of an Ro system.

Typically, residential properties such as single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-unit buildings benefit from Ro system installation. These systems are especially popular in households that rely on well water or have concerns about municipal water quality. Commercial properties, small offices, and food service establishments may also use these systems to ensure their water meets specific standards for safety and taste. The overview below groups typical Ro System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Baltimore County,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or Ro system repairs or component replacements generally range from $150 to $400.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the lower or higher ends of the spectrum.

Basic System Installations - Installing a standard RO system usually costs between $250 and $600, depending on the system type and complexity. Local contractors often complete these jobs within this range, though larger homes may see higher costs.

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ire Ro system can range from $600 to $1,200 for most residential setups. Larger or more advanced systems can push costs into the $1,500 range, especially for custom or multi-stage units.

Complex or Commercial Projects - Larger, more complex RO installations for commercial properties or multi-unit buildings can exceed $5,000. These projects are less common and typically involve additional plumbing or specialized equipment, leading to higher cost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When selecting a professional for Ro system install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ects in Baltimore County and nearby areas.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a track record of successfully completing water treatment system installations comparable to their needs. Asking about the types of systems they have installed and the complexity of past projects can help gauge their familiarity with local requirements and challenges, ensuring the chosen contractor has the practical knowledge necessary for a smooth installation process.

Clear written expectations are a key factor in choosing the right contractor. Homeowners should seek service providers who provide detailed proposals outlining the scope of work, materials to be used, and any other relevant project specifics.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project. It’s also beneficial to verify that the contractor’s approach aligns with the homeowner’s goals and that there is a mutual understanding of what the installation will involve.

Reputable references and effective communication are essential when comparing local contractors. Homeowners are encouraged to ask for references from previous clients who had similar systems installed, especially within the local area. This can provide insights into the contractor’s reliability, workmanship, and professionalism. Additionally, choosing a service provider who communicates clearly and promptly can make the entire process more straightforward and less stressful. Good communication ensures that questions are answered, expectations are managed, and any concerns are addressed throughout the project.

What does Ro system installation involve? Ro system installation typically includes setting up the filtration unit, connecting it to the water supply, and ensuring proper operation for clean drinking water.

Are there different types of Ro systems available? Yes, there are various types of Ro systems designed for different household needs, including under-sink units and whole-house solutions.

How do I choose the right local contractor for Ro system installation? Consider reviewing the experience and reputation of local service providers who specialize in water filtration system installations in Baltimore County, MD.

What should I expect during a Ro system installation? A professional installer will typically set up the unit, connect it to your water line, and test the system to ensure proper functioning.

Can a local contractor help with system maintenance after installation? Many local service providers also offer maintenance and repair services to keep your Ro system functioning effectively over time.
